What is the definition of Sin(A)?

Back

Sin(A) is defined as the ratio of the length of the opposite side (a) to the length of the hypotenuse (c) in a right triangle. Thus, Sin(A) = a/c.

What is the definition of Cos(A)?

Back

Cos(A) is defined as the ratio of the length of the adjacent side (b) to the length of the hypotenuse (c) in a right triangle. Thus, Cos(A) = b/c.

What is the definition of Tan(A)?

Back

Tan(A) is defined as the ratio of the length of the opposite side (a) to the length of the adjacent side (b) in a right triangle. Thus, Tan(A) = a/b.

What is the relationship between Sin, Cos, and Tan?

Back

The relationship is given by the equation Tan(A) = Sin(A) / Cos(A).

What is the Pythagorean identity involving Sin and Cos?

Back

The Pythagorean identity states that Sin^2(A) + Cos^2(A) = 1.
